The road is rugged, and the sun is hot. How can we be but weary? Here is grace for the weariness – grace which lifts us up and invigorates us; grace which keeps us from fainting by the way; grace which supplies us with manna from heaven, and with water from the smitten rock. We receive of this grace, and are revived. Our weariness of heart and limb departs. We need no other refreshment. This is enough. Whatever the way be – rough, gloomy, unpleasant – we press forward, knowing that the same grace that has already carried thousands through will do the same for us.
Horatius Bonar

INSTRUCTIONS
* Cut the cilantro stems into 1/2-inch pieces.
~-------------------------------------------------------------------------
Place all ingredients except cilantro and paprika in food processor work
bowl fitted with steel blade; cover and process until smooth, about 1
minute. Roll mixture by teaspoonfuls into chile shapes. Insert cilantro
pieces in wide ends of shape fro stems. Sprinkle with paprika. Cover and
refrigerate until serving time.
